Hydrogen-mixed natural gas pipeline valve chamber safe emptying system and method
A technology for a hydrogen-mixed natural gas and venting system is applied in the field of safe venting system of a valve chamber of a hydrogen-mixed natural gas pipeline, which can solve the problem of frictional spontaneous combustion, and it is also possible that the medium may be ignited by the outside near the nozzle when the medium leaves the venting riser, which is easy to induce deflagration or explosion. and other problems, to achieve the effect of ensuring the release rate, preventing the release and spreading, and avoiding safety problems.

[0024] A safe venting system for the valve room of a hydrogen-mixed natural gas pipeline, which mainly includes: main line pipeline 1, cut off ball valve 2, main line bypass 3, pressure transmitter 4 / 5 / 6, bypass cut valve 7 / 8, bypass external pipeline 9. High-pressure branch pipe 10, vent cut-off valve 11 / 13, restrictor orifice 12 / 14, vent manifold 15, vent main pipe 16, vent torch 17, replacement gas injection branch pipe 31 / 32, replacement exhaust branch pipe 33 / 34 / 35. Flare cushion gas injection branch pipe 36, shut-off valve 18 / 19 / 20 / 22 / 24 / 26, check valve 21 / 23 / 25, flow transmitter 27, flame arrestor 28.
